Commit 0c2c99b1b "memory hotplug: Allow memory blocks to span multiple memory sections" introduced a weak memory_block_size_bytes() function which can be used to set the size of a memory block as seen in sysfs. Provide an s390 specific override which makes sure that each memory block has at least a size of 256MB or the increment size of of a memory increment, whatever is larger. This way we can make sure that the number of memory sysfs objects doesn't explode for very large memory configurations.
